It is the mission of Richmond Early College High School (REaCH) to promote academic excellence, civic responsibility, respect of all individuals, and success in all endeavors.  Our students will be connected, productive members of the community.

Richmond Early College High School (REaCH) will provide a school climate enabling students to feel free to accept and express ideas without fear or prejudice. Students will communicate openly with not only other students, but also with the staff. This open communication will foster positive relationships.
